Xiaoxiao Cui is a robotics researcher specializing in intelligent inspection systems for smart substations, with a primary focus on visual servo control and autonomous navigation. Her most cited work, "An adapted visual servo algorithm for substation equipment inspection robot" (2016, 6 citations), addresses a critical challenge in industrial automation: enabling robots to accurately capture and recognize target images in real-time within complex substation environments. Cui proposed an adapted efficient robotics visual servo algorithm that significantly improves the precision of image acquisition, allowing inspection robots to reliably monitor the operational status of various equipment. This contribution is vital for enhancing the safety, efficiency, and reliability of smart grid maintenance, reducing human intervention in hazardous high-voltage environments.
